Transaction f76564aa0818305571027316a905aeb814f7ab5cc037ca17c9e1c6f89e63b892

173 Input
2 Outputs
  • f76564aa0818305571027316a905aeb814f7ab5cc037ca17c9e1c6f89e63b892:0
  • value  32100000
    address  bc1q0zuqm0204yewl8sa0cgjexxxhnv30x9az0rzp0
  • f76564aa0818305571027316a905aeb814f7ab5cc037ca17c9e1c6f89e63b892:1
  • value  105681
    address  3BQxydJrKXASYymiJC6NgWNJgzXtg5b8Zs